About the Role
Hill McGlynn is partnering with a well-established regional subcontractor specializing in civils and groundworks. We are seeking an experienced Civils Commercial Manager to take a hands-on leadership role within their team in Gravesend. This is a unique opportunity for a proactive professional who combines strong commercial management skills with estimating and surveying expertise to drive the success of high-profile projects across the region.

Key Responsibilities

  • Leading commercial activities on civils and groundworks projects, ensuring profitability and risk management.
  • Overseeing and contributing to estimating and tendering processes, supporting the business from the ground up.
  • Managing subcontractor and supplier relationships, negotiations, and procurement.
  • Conducting cost control, value engineering, and financial reporting to ensure projects stay within budget.
  • Participating directly in surveying duties, including measurement and valuation, to maintain hands-on involvement.
  • Collaborating closely with project teams, clients, and stakeholders to facilitate smooth project delivery.
  • Mentoring junior surveyors and estimators, fostering a collaborative and efficient working environment.
  • Ensuring compliance with health and safety standards and contractual obligations.

About You
The ideal candidate will have:

  • Significant experience as a Commercial Manager within civils or groundworks sectors, with a strong estimating background.
  • Proven ability to manage multiple projects and lead commercial teams effectively.
  • Hands-on experience with estimating, surveying, and project cost control.
  • Excellent negotiation and communication skills.
  • A relevant qualification in Quantity Surveying, Civil Engineering, or a related discipline.
  • A proactive, practical approach with a focus on delivering results.
